dot Music: A Domain Name Extension for the Music Industry

While attending MIDEM last week, I met Constantine Roussos, founder of the ".music" top level domain name initiative. Essentially, he's attempting to generate enough public support to successfully petition ICANN to add .music to the existing list of Generic Top Level Domain Name extensions, such as .com, .net, .org, etc. Constantine has already received over 1 million signatures supporting the .music extension, but it has not yet been approved, even though extensions like .biz, .jobs, .mobi, .museum, .name, .travel and others already exist.

While the majority of musicians, bands and music industry companies rely on .com and/or .net for their URLs, domain names for these extensions are scare, and I think the music industry would not only benefit from a specific extension, but would welcome it.
